APRIL 18 – THE BRIDE OF CHRIST

SCRIPTURE

“Now as the church submits to Christ, so also wives should submit to their husbands in everything. Husbands, love your wives, just as Christ loved the church and gave himself up for her to make her holy, cleansing her by the washing with water through the word, and to present her to himself as a radiant church, without stain or wrinkle or any other blemish, but holy and blameless” Ephesians 5:24-27 (NIV).

MESSAGE

The Church is called the Bride of Christ and Christ is the Head of the Church. Paul in the above scripture was talking about Christ and the church and metaphorically compared it to the husband and the wife.  The Lord Jesus Christ’s love for His bride, “the Church”, was expressed by how He gave Himself for her. “Christ loved the church and gave himself up for her to make her holy, cleansing her by the washing with water through the word” Ephesians 5:26. Jesus loved the Church and gave Himself up for her as its Savior (John 3:16). The Bride is to submit to the authority and Lordship of Christ (the bridegroom) to be nurtured and enriched in every way. 

The goal of Christ is to sanctify His Bride “and to present her to himself as a radiant church, without stain or wrinkle or any other blemish, but holy and blameless” Ephesians 5:27. We are talking about the love of the Lord Jesus for the church (His bride). Nothing shall separate us from the love of Christ (Romans 8:35-37). In talking about the Church as the Bride, Apostle Paul said,I am jealous for you with a godly jealousy. I promised you to one husband, to Christ, so that I might present you as a pure virgin to him” 2 Corinthians 11:2 (NIV). You are married to one Husband, the Lord Jesus Christ, and you are to remain faithful and loyal, waiting in anticipation for the glorious day to be united with Him forever.
